Abstract

The invention discloses a kind of stacked oil cooler, including housing and the inner fin group being arranged on housing cavity, housing includes shell, inlet channel, outlet conduit, inflow pipeline and flowline.Inner fin group includes the split type inner fin of some pieces of stackings, one end of runner plate is provided with medium entrance and media outlet, the other end of runner plate is provided with the first isolation boss and the second isolation boss, first isolation boss is provided centrally with the first through hole, and the second isolation boss is provided centrally with the second through hole.Medium entrance and the first isolation boss are centrosymmetric, and media outlet and the second isolation boss are centrosymmetric;Isolation strip it is provided with in runner plate.All fit the lower surface of lastblock runner plate, medium entrance and the interval stacking of the first through hole, media outlet and the interval stacking of the second through hole in first isolation boss, the second isolation boss and the isolation strip of each piece of runner plate.Forming water and the interlayer superposition of oil with this, heat exchange efficiency is high.

A kind of stacked oil cooler
Technical field
The invention belongs to the technical field of heat abstractor, specifically, relate to a kind of stacked oil cooler.
Background technology
Oil cooler is high due to compact conformation, heat exchange efficiency at present, is widely used in electromotor and variable-speed motor etc. Field.Owing to the oil density needing cooling is higher, for reducing the resistance of oil cooler inner flow passage, oil inlet pipe, go out It is more reasonable that the location layout of oil pipe, water inlet pipe and outlet pipe needs;The flow path features of oil and the flow path portion of water Part differs, and increases the workload of the manufacturing process of parts.
Summary of the invention
In order to overcome above-mentioned deficiency of the prior art, it is an object of the invention to provide a kind of stacked oil cooler, This device has the advantages that to use the parts of centrosymmetric structure to realize structure simplification.
In order to achieve the above object, the solution that the present invention uses is: a kind of stacked oil cooler, including Housing and the inner fin group being arranged on housing cavity, housing includes shell, inlet channel, outlet conduit, enters Oil-piping and flowline;Shell includes the first bottom panel and the second bottom panel, inlet channel and outlet conduit It is fixedly connected on the first bottom panel, inflow pipeline and flowline and is fixedly connected on the second bottom panel.
Inner fin group includes the split type inner fin of some pieces of stackings, and split type inner fin includes inner fin body And runner plate;The bar shaped platy structure that runner plate is centrosymmetric, one end of runner plate is provided with medium entrance And media outlet, the other end of runner plate is provided with the first isolation boss and the second isolation boss, the first isolation Boss is provided centrally with the first through hole, and the second isolation boss is provided centrally with the second through hole.Medium entrance and One isolation boss is centrosymmetric, and media outlet and the second isolation boss are centrosymmetric;Arrange in runner plate There is the isolation strip for increasing flow channel length;First isolation boss, the second isolation boss and isolation strip are contour. Runner plate edge is provided with crimping.First isolation boss of each piece of runner plate, the second isolation boss and isolation Band is all fitted the lower surface of lastblock runner plate, medium entrance and the interval stacking of the first through hole, media outlet and Second through hole interval stacking.
First isolation boss, the second isolation boss and the isolation strip and the of the runner plate of top in inner fin group One bottom panel laminating;The runner plate of top and inlet channel and outlet conduit conducting, interior wing in inner fin group The runner plate of the bottom and inflow pipeline and flowline conducting in sheet group.
Further, inner fin body includes the first inner fin, the second inner fin and the 3rd inner fin;First The first gap wide outside and narrow inside it is provided with between inner fin and the 3rd inner fin;Wing in second inner fin and the 3rd The second gap wide outside and narrow inside it is provided with between sheet.
Further, runner plate is divided into the first straight channel, the second straight channel and the runner that turns round by isolation strip; First inner fin and the fixing connection of the first straight channel upper surface;Second inner fin and the second straight channel upper surface are solid Fixed connection;3rd inner fin is fixing with the runner upper surface that turns round to be connected.
Further, the diameter of the first isolation boss is more than the diameter of medium entrance;Second isolates the straight of boss Footpath is more than the diameter of media outlet.
Further, the upper surface of the first bottom panel is fixedly connected with the first mounting blocks and the second mounting blocks;The The lower surface of two bottom panels is fixedly connected with the 3rd mounting blocks.
Shell is also provided with side panel, and side panel is coated on inner fin group side surface, and side panel and Two bottom panels are fixing to be connected, and forms the protection of internal fins set.
The invention has the beneficial effects as follows, runner plate be centrosymmetric structure, medium entrance and the first boss in The heart is symmetrical, and media outlet and the second boss are centrosymmetric, in two pieces of adjacent split type inner fins, on One piece of split type inner fin is stacking after the split type inner fin of next block rotates 180 °, is consequently formed medium entrance And the first through hole interval stacking, media outlet and the interval stacking of the second through hole, due to the first isolation boss and the The sealing function of two isolation boss, forms water and the interlayer superposition of oil, and heat exchange efficiency is high.

Detailed description of the invention
Below in conjunction with accompanying drawing, the invention will be further described:
The present invention provides a kind of stacked oil cooler, as shown in Figures 1 and 2, including housing 1 and peace Be contained in the inner fin group 2 of housing 1 inner chamber, housing 1 include shell 11, inlet channel 12, outlet conduit 13, Inflow pipeline 14 and flowline 15.Shell 11 includes the first bottom panel 11a and the second bottom panel 11b, Inlet channel 12 and outlet conduit 13 are fixedly connected on the first bottom panel 11a, inflow pipeline 14 and flowline Road 15 is fixedly connected on the second bottom panel 11b.
As shown in Figure 3, inner fin group 2 includes the split type inner fin 3 of some pieces of stackings, such as accompanying drawing 8 He Shown in accompanying drawing 9, split type inner fin 3 includes inner fin body 4 and runner plate 5;Runner plate 5 is in center pair The bar shaped platy structure claimed, one end of runner plate 5 is provided with medium entrance 51 and media outlet 52, runner plate The other end of 5 is provided with the first isolation boss 53 and the second isolation boss 54, the first isolation boss 53 center Being provided with the first through hole 53a, the second isolation boss 54 is provided centrally with the second through hole 54a.Medium entrance 51 Being centrosymmetric with the first isolation boss 53, media outlet 52 and the second isolation boss 54 are centrosymmetric; As shown in accompanying drawing 6 and accompanying drawing 7, in two pieces of adjacent split type inner fins 3, the split type interior wing of lastblock Sheet 3 is stacking after the split type inner fin of next block 3 rotates 180 °, is consequently formed medium entrance 51 and first Through hole 53a is spaced stacking, and media outlet 52 and the second through hole 54a is spaced stacking;As shown in Figure 5, One isolation boss 53 and the second isolation boss 54 are fitted in last layer runner plate 5 lower surface, due to first every From boss 53 and the sealing function of the second isolation boss 54, form water and the interlayer superposition of oil.
Being provided with isolation strip 55 in runner plate 5, isolation strip 55 is fitted in last layer runner plate 5 lower surface, uses In increasing flow channel length.Boss 54 isolated by first isolation boss 53, second and isolation strip 55 is contour.Runner Plate 5 edge is provided with crimping 56.
In inner fin group 2 first isolation boss 53, second of the runner plate 5 of top isolate boss 54 and every From band 55 and the first bottom panel 11a laminating;The runner plate 5 of top and inlet channel 12 in inner fin group 2 Turn on outlet conduit 13, the runner plate 5 of the bottom and inflow pipeline 14 and flowline in inner fin group 2 Road 15 turns on, and prevents the crossfire of oil and water.
As shown in Figure 8, in inner fin body 4 includes first inner fin the 41, second inner fin 42 and the 3rd Fin 43;Runner plate 5 is divided into the first straight channel the 57, second straight channel 58 and stream that turns round by isolation strip 55 Road 59;First inner fin 41 is fixing with the first straight channel 57 upper surface to be connected;Second inner fin 42 and second Straight channel 58 upper surface is fixing to be connected;3rd inner fin 43 is fixing with runner 59 upper surface that turns round to be connected.The It is provided with the first gap 44 wide outside and narrow inside between one inner fin 41 and the 3rd inner fin 43;Second inner fin 42 and the 3rd are provided with the second gap 45 wide outside and narrow inside between inner fin 43.Between the first gap 44 and second Gap 45 reduces medium in the flow resistance of runner 59 of turning round.
The diameter of the first isolation boss 53 is more than the diameter of medium entrance 51;The diameter of the second isolation boss 54 Diameter more than media outlet 52, it is ensured that the sealing effectiveness of isolation boss.
As shown in Figure 2, the upper surface of the first bottom panel 11a is fixedly connected with the first mounting blocks 6 and second Mounting blocks 7;The lower surface of the second bottom panel 11b is fixedly connected with the 3rd mounting blocks 8, it is simple to whole device Install.
Shell is also provided with side panel, and as shown in Figure 4, side panel is coated on inner fin group side surface, And side panel and the second bottom panel are fixing connects, form the protection of internal fins set.
